I'm telling you, there is a GOOD chance the Wii U outsells the Xbone. And to those who say I'm jumping the gun, I've made this claim LONG before the Xbone even came out. People tend to just lump the Xbone and PS4 together and think that since PS4 will (likely) smoke the Wii U in sales, Xbone will do the same (I guess since they're so damn similar anyway). Just because they're similar, doesn't mean they will share the same fate. I think Xbone has a good chance to end up at least a few million behind the Wii U in sales. Think about it..

- Nintendo currently owns Japan, a place where MS is conversely, almost a non entity in.
- Nintendo is also more popular in non-UK Europe for the most part than MS.
- They have a huge price advantage, as well a huge advantage in quality library thus far.
- They are far more vulnerable to getting their sales cannibalized by Sony than Nintendo, as they are very similar.
- Nintendo has many highly regarded franchises to push hardware, while MS has a bunch of third parties, and Halo and Gears..
